Transaction 65b35a21ca0f99aa811962003948188d80d526ed815bd8669e7af24131a63474
1 Input
1 Output
-
65b35a21ca0f99aa811962003948188d80d526ed815bd8669e7af24131a63474:0
- value
- 36808
- script pubkey
- OP_0 OP_PUSHBYTES_20 70ac1941c7143b672b064e0dcb5e1ccacea3e35c
- address
- bc1qwzkpjsw8zsakw2cxfcxukhsuet828c6uuhjkpa